在当今互联网时代,网络安全和隐私愈发重要。V2Ray作为一种现代化的代理工具,为用户提供了便捷的解决方案。本文将详细介绍如何搭建V2Ray服务器,从基础知识到具体操作,让您轻松掌握这一强大工具的使用。
什么是V2Ray?
V2Ray是一个开源的网络代理工具,支持多种协议,如VMess、VLess、Shadowsocks等。其设计目的是为了在复杂的网络环境中提供更安全、更快速的访问。
V2Ray的主要特点
- 多协议支持:除了VMess外,V2Ray还支持Shadowsocks、HTTP等协议。
- 灵活的路由功能:可以根据不同的域名、IP、地理位置进行灵活的流量分配。
- 强大的加密功能:提供多种加密方式,保障用户的数据安全。
如何搭建V2Ray服务器
搭建V2Ray服务器的过程相对简单,但需要遵循一定的步骤。以下是具体的操作流程:
第一步:准备服务器
- 选择云服务提供商,例如阿里云、AWS、Vultr等。
- 创建一台适合自己需求的虚拟私有服务器(VPS)。
- 选择合适的操作系统(推荐使用Ubuntu或CentOS)。
第二步:安装V2Ray
在准备好服务器后,可以开始安装V2Ray。以下是在Ubuntu上的安装步骤:
-
更新系统:运行命令: bash sudo apt update && sudo apt upgrade
-
下载V2Ray安装脚本:运行命令: bash bash <(curl -s -L https://git.io/v2ray.sh)
-
配置V2Ray:安装完成后,可以编辑配置文件,路径通常为
/etc/v2ray/config.json
。
第三步:配置V2Ray
配置V2Ray时,需要设置几个关键参数:
- 端口:建议使用1024以上的端口。
- 用户ID:生成UUID,用于身份验证。
- 网络协议:根据需求选择合适的协议(如VMess或VLess)。
第四步:启动V2Ray服务
完成配置后,可以通过以下命令启动V2Ray: bash sudo systemctl start v2ray
并设置为开机自启: bash sudo systemctl enable v2ray
如何使用V2Ray客户端
在服务器搭建完成后,您需要配置客户端才能连接到V2Ray服务器。以下是配置步骤:
下载客户端
根据您的设备系统,选择适合的V2Ray客户端。常用客户端有:
- Windows:V2RayN
- macOS:V2RayU
- Android:V2RayNG
- iOS:Shadowrocket
配置客户端
- 打开客户端。
- 添加新连接,输入服务器IP、端口、用户ID等信息。
- 保存并连接,测试连接是否成功。
常见问题解答(FAQ)
Q1: V2Ray安全性如何?
A1: V2Ray采用了多种加密方式,并支持复杂的路由规则,因此在数据传输过程中具有较高的安全性。同时,使用正规渠道获取V2Ray可以降低安全风险。
Q2: V2Ray适合什么样的用户?
A2: V2Ray适合需要翻墙、保护隐私及提升网络访问速度的用户,特别是在访问受到限制的地区。
Q3: 如何保持V2Ray的更新?
A3: 定期检查V2Ray的官方网站或GitHub仓库,按照更新日志进行更新。
Q4: V2Ray和Shadowsocks有什么区别?
A4: V2Ray是一种多协议的代理工具,支持更复杂的路由和加密方式,而Shadowsocks则是一种轻量级的代理协议,适合简单的使用场景。
Q5: 使用V2Ray会影响网速吗?
A5: V2Ray在合适配置下,理论上不会影响网速。相反,在某些情况下,它可以提升访问速度,尤其是在网络受限的情况下。
结论
搭建V2Ray服务器虽然需要一定的技术知识,但通过上述步骤,您可以轻松上手。希望本文能帮助您更好地理解和使用V2Ray,保障您的网络安全与隐私。如果您还有其他问题,欢迎留言讨论!